Web Applications Programmer
University of Rochester
Rochester, NY Metropolitan Statistical Area

**POSITION SUMMARY:**  
The River Campus Libraries seek a web applications programmer to join the
Information Discovery Team, the unit charged with developing the tools and
interfaces to expose our rich content and academic resources to the UR
community and the world. This position will be responsible for various web
development projects that serve the evolving needs of the faculty and students
of the University. The primary responsibility is to develop cutting-edge
websites and digital projects, in close collaboration with the rest of the
team. The position reports to the Director of the Information Discovery Team.

  
**SPECIFIC RESPONSIBILITIES:**  
  
25% Web Application Programming and Development

  * Collaborates with stakeholders across the River Campus Libraries to find opportunities to build upon and improve RCL's various web platforms and tools
  * Develops robust and user-friendly library tools using a variety of programming languages, for both external and internal stakeholders, working closely with the Interface Designer
  * Creates code to integrate web services with various commercial library products, including search and retrieval, metadata harvesting, and discovery
  * Develops programmatic solutions to reduce time investments and errors in manual workflows
  
25% Code Implementation and Testing

  * Participates in the design of software platform architectures and databases when appropriate and in collaboration with the Information Discovery Team
  * Tests and improves web applications based on expert analysis, user requirements, designs, and professional judgment
  * Develops testing protocols to ensure successful software releases
  * Works closely with members of the Information Discovery Team and other library stakeholders to understand project requirements and develop the best solution possible
25% Troubleshooting and Support

  * Receive and manage support requests
  * Troubleshoot, plan, and resolve problems in a highly collaborative environment
  * Provides consultation support on systems and programs
15% Project Planning and Documentation

  * Produces well designed, documented, and tested code
  * Deploys and maintains the code base for completed applications
10% Professional Development and Service

  * Collaborates and communicate with various RCL stakeholders
  * Keeps abreast of trends as they relate to academic library website services, electronic resource management, digital library networks, metadata schemas, database technology or other relevant areas by self-study, attending job related seminars, courses, or conferences which enhance personal development and strengthens the RCL's information technology framework to support teaching and learning
  * Participates in RCL and University-wide committees and meetings required by supervisor
  * Performs other related duties as required
**Qualifications and Experience:**

  * Bachelor's degree in related discipline such as Computer Science, and 2-3 years of related experience; or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
  * Expertise with web application development and programming (HTML, CSS, PHP, and Javascript)
  * Experience integrating web applications with various components and web services
  * Experience with version control; GitHub preferred
  * Experience with Drupal theme and module development preferred
  * Excellent communication skills and technical aptitude
  * Familiarity with library technologies and standards
  * Ability to work collaboratively with diverse groups in project planning and development
  * Ability to handle simultaneous projects and clearly articulate how the project tasks are being prioritized
